Birchwood sits close enough to Bellingham Bay and the surrounding wetlands that homes here take on a specific combination of weather stress: salt-laden air off the water, long stretches of driving rain pushed in by wind off the Strait, and a moss season that can run most of the year in shaded, north-facing spots. None of that is unique to one street or one house style in the neighborhood — it's the baseline every window on a Birchwood home has to survive, year after year. A window that's rated fine for a dry inland climate can still underperform here if the frame material, glazing, and installation detailing weren't chosen with this kind of moisture and salt exposure in mind.
Energy efficiency and durability aren't separate conversations in this climate — they're the same conversation. A window that's leaking air is very often also a window whose seals, weep holes, or flashing are letting in moisture, and moisture is what starts the slow damage that shows up years later as soft framing, fogged glass, or stained siding below the sill. Getting this right the first time matters more here than in a milder climate, because a marginal install doesn't just cost you on the heating bill — it costs you in wood rot and callback repairs.

What "Energy-Efficient" Actually Means for a Window
The phrase gets used loosely, so it's worth being specific about what actually makes a window perform well in Whatcom County conditions.
Glazing and Gas Fill
Dual-pane windows with a low-E coating are the practical standard for this region — they cut down on both heat loss in winter and unwanted solar gain in summer. Argon gas fill between the panes adds a modest insulation boost and is standard on most quality window lines now; it's a reasonable upgrade, not a gimmick. Triple-pane is available and does add performance, but for most Birchwood homes the return on investment is better spent on getting the frame, flashing, and installation right than on the third pane of glass.
Frame Material and Thermal Break
The frame is where a lot of window quality is decided, and it's also where our regional weather does the most damage over time. Look for a documented thermal break in the frame construction — this is what keeps the interior frame surface from getting cold enough to condensate and fog in our damp winters.
Weatherstripping and Seal Quality
Even a well-rated window underperforms if the weatherstripping compresses poorly or degrades in UV and salt exposure within a few years. This is a detail that's hard to evaluate from a spec sheet, which is one of the reasons why buying based on brand reputation and installer experience matters as much as buying based on published U-factor numbers.
Signs Your Birchwood Home's Windows Are Underperforming
Homeowners often notice comfort problems before they notice the underlying cause. A few patterns we see regularly in this neighborhood:
- Condensation or fogging between the panes — the seal has failed and the insulating gas has escaped.
- A noticeable draft or cold spot near the window frame even with the sash fully latched.
- Soft or discolored wood trim around the window, especially on the sill or lower corners.
- Visible moss or dark streaking on the exterior casing or siding directly below the window.
- Difficulty opening, closing, or latching a window that used to operate smoothly — often a sign the frame has swelled or shifted.
- A noticeable jump in heating costs without a clear explanation elsewhere in the house.
Any one of these on its own isn't necessarily an emergency, but they're worth having looked at before the underlying moisture problem spreads into the wall assembly.
Choosing the Right Window Type and Materials
There's no single "best" window for every Birchwood home — the right choice depends on the home's exposure, existing construction, and how much upkeep the homeowner wants to take on. Here's how the common frame materials compare for this specific climate:
| Frame Material | Salt Air / Moisture Performance | Maintenance Load | Where It Fits Best |
|---|---|---|---|
| Vinyl | Good — won't rot or corrode, handles moisture well | Low | Most standard replacement projects; strong value |
| Fiberglass | Very good — dimensionally stable, resists warping in temperature swings | Low | Larger openings, homes wanting long-term stability |
| Wood-clad | Fair — the exterior cladding protects the wood, but any breach in that cladding invites rot | Higher | Homes prioritizing an interior wood look; needs disciplined upkeep |
| Aluminum | Poor without thermal break — conducts cold and can corrode near salt air over time | Moderate | Rarely our recommendation for this climate on its own |
Our default recommendation for most Birchwood homes is vinyl or fiberglass, specifically because both shrug off the moisture and salt exposure this area sees without asking the homeowner to keep up with painting or sealant maintenance. Wood-clad windows can still be the right call for a homeowner who wants that look and is willing to stay on top of caulking and inspection — we're honest about that trade-off rather than steering everyone toward the lowest-maintenance option regardless of preference.
Our Installation Process
Replacement window failures are far more often an installation problem than a product problem. The window itself can be well-built and still fail early if the flashing, sealing, or fastening wasn't done correctly for the specific wall assembly it's going into. Our process is built around getting those details right:
- On-site assessment. We look at the existing window, the surrounding trim and siding condition, and any signs of prior moisture intrusion before recommending a scope of work.
- Product selection. We walk through frame material, glazing, and grille or hardware options based on the home's exposure and the homeowner's priorities — cost, appearance, or long-term low maintenance.
- Removal and inspection. Once the old window is out, we check the rough opening and sill for hidden rot or damage before anything new goes in — this is the step that gets skipped in a rushed install and causes problems years later.
- Flashing and sealing. Proper flashing tape and sealant placement is what actually keeps driving rain out of the wall cavity — this matters more in Bellingham's weather than almost any other part of the job.
- Setting and fastening. The window is shimmed, leveled, and fastened per manufacturer specification to keep it square and operating smoothly for the long term.
- Interior and exterior finish. Trim, caulking, and touch-up work are completed so the finished opening looks clean and is fully sealed.
- Final walkthrough. We test operation on every window and review care basics with the homeowner before considering the job done.
Why Local Installation Experience Matters
A crew that already works in Bellingham and across Whatcom County has seen how homes in this specific climate age — which flashing details hold up, which frame materials handle salt air well over a decade, and which trim details tend to trap moisture instead of shedding it. That's not something you can substitute with a general contractor's checklist from a drier region. Local experience also means we're not learning on your house how driving rain interacts with a particular siding-to-window transition — we've already worked through that on other homes nearby.
It also means realistic scheduling and honest expectations. Window installation has a weather window of its own — wet, windy conditions make it harder to keep an open wall cavity dry during the swap — and a local crew plans around that instead of promising a timeline that doesn't account for it.
Maintenance in a Salt Air, Moss-Prone Climate
Even a well-installed, high-quality window benefits from basic seasonal attention in this climate. A simple maintenance routine goes a long way toward protecting the investment:
- Rinse exterior frames periodically to clear salt residue, especially on homes with more direct exposure to the bay.
- Keep gutters and nearby drainage clear so runoff isn't sheeting directly across window trim.
- Check and clear weep holes on vinyl and fiberglass frames so condensation and rain can drain as designed.
- Inspect exterior caulking annually and re-seal any cracked or separated joints before they let water in.
- Watch for moss or algae buildup on shaded window trim and clean it before it holds moisture against the wood or finish.
- Operate each window through its full range at least seasonally so hardware doesn't seize from disuse.
What Affects the Cost of a Birchwood Window Project
Every home is different, but a few factors consistently move the price on a window replacement project in this area: the number and size of openings, frame material choice, whether the existing trim or siding needs repair from prior moisture damage, and how many windows are being done at once versus one at a time. Broadly, a straightforward vinyl replacement will run less than a comparable fiberglass or wood-clad installation, and any project that uncovers hidden rot in the rough opening will cost more once that repair is factored in.
